4. GSIRS - GreenSeas Industrial Repair School
GreenSeas' GSIRS evolved from its internal need to train and certify its workforce for its own deployment needs. In the meantime, its growth as a company and subsequently deployment needs, increased its training requirements thereby better improving methodology to process and certify its men in greater numbers. They have been certifying all of its steel welders with Germanischer Lloyd for years and recently with its expansion into the land based industrial sector, aluminum and stainless steel TIG welders have become the norm. To date, they are one of the large employers of specialized Aluminum and TIG welders in Europe. Since 2005, the concept of GSIRS was established and a mobile training program was implemented. GSIRS can now TRAIN and HAVE CERTIFIED workers from local populations like in West Africa in a weekly school conducted by GSIRS men, at any location where they are deployed. Depending on the training program adopted, we can produce a functional welder, fitter or assistant in as little as 3 months, one capable of handling rudimentary steel applications and uties. Certification of said candidate can be arranged using a variety of options and certification agencies.

7. Patents application
VELIKAR's CEO and Executive Director namely Stefanos Kouloumbis and Antonio Giglio respectively, have exclusive rights in West Africa for the promotion of the Ecological Desalination YDRIADA
On a special floating platform a wind turbine and photovoltaic systems, produces and supplies through advance electrical and electronic energy, conversion components, energy to a desalination unit which uses reverse osmosis technique, in order to produce potable water from the sea. No chemical additives are used in the desalination process. The platform is designed in such a way that it remains stable even with adverse weather conditions (has faced so far winds up to 120 km/hour, without any problems).
PRODUCTION :
Best quality potable water (enhanced with minerals)
NEW MODEL :
1,000,000 LTR/day for Sea Water
3,000,000 LTR/day for brackish water (about)
5,000,000 LTR/day for river water (upto)
